This painting depicts the episode of the Vase of Soissons, associated with the reign of Clovis in the 5th century. After a victory over Roman forces, a Frankish soldier broke a valuable vase that Clovis wished to return to the Church. A year later, the king punished the soldier in front of the army, asserting his authority. This story, blending history and tradition, symbolizes the strengthening of royal power and the alliance between Clovis and the Church. It also illustrates discipline and obedience within the Frankish kingdom.
